How this Georgia factory is surviving America’s solar policy whiplash

This post was originally published on this site.


As the Trump administration implements new tariffs and minimum import prices on polysilicon, QCells is expanding its Cartersville, Georgia, facility to house the entire solar cell production process under one roof by late October.
